Transaction 37c29a7330de745640ff1673be84f5bfeccacd09cf8114164051e76b03adacb1

1 Input
2 Outputs
  • 37c29a7330de745640ff1673be84f5bfeccacd09cf8114164051e76b03adacb1:0
  • value  164775030
    address  3FaRBqzuHDayvbQwX9znYu57HUbPtTSkrW
  • 37c29a7330de745640ff1673be84f5bfeccacd09cf8114164051e76b03adacb1:1
  • value  25000000
    address  1GkcdviyavQuquMMtLVNbtxZ4y9Y5MYr6r